Coal-tar sealcoat is loaded with polycyclic aromatic hydrocarbons. Worn particles track indoors on shoes and tyres: US Geological Survey sampling found PAH in house dust about 25 times higher in homes beside coal-tar-sealed lots than beside plain asphalt or concrete.

Cleaner swap → An asphalt-based sealer, or leaving the surface unsealed.
